Rick Brantley Performing at 12th and Porter

Rick Brantley was one of the two artists that opened for Shirock last weekend at 12th and Porter. Often performing acoustically, he chose to plug it in this time to present his softer blend of southern rock. Combine that with the close quarters atmosphere of 12th and Porter and it was a really fun way to kick off the evening.

Picking Up the Everything Burns Tour

This past weekend Shirock kicked off their Everything Burns tour. More than just a great way to launch their new debut album of the same name, Everything Burns is also the non-profit charity started by the band. 100% of the proceeds from each event will go to their charity, or to another local organization which the band is partnering with in the 14 cities which they will visit this month.
